The patient lies supine with the hips and knees flexed to 90 and grasps behind both of his or her thighs to stabilise the hip joints then actively extends each knee in turn. 90-90 STRAIGHT LEG RAISE TEST FOR HAMSTRING LENGTH. The 9090 test also known as the Active Knee Extension AKE Hamstring Flexibility Test measures hamstring flexibility particularly when the hip is flexed.

The patient is positioned in supine with the hip of the tested leg in 90 degrees of flexionThe contralateral leg stays flat on the examination table.
